Saxe-Ernestine. A House Order, Commander's Star With Swords, C.1860 Auction Archive set of very fine quality"Fr Inlnder", Type I (1833 1864); In silver, Swords and center applique in Gold and enamels, measuring 78mm x 77mm, center motto letters in Gold and hand chiseled,with screw back fastening device on reverse, unmarked, of excellent quality manufacture, very slight enamel chipping, in extremely fine condition and rare.
